Goodman Masson is seeking a Contracts Lead for a PE-backed energy business in Greater London. The role involves end-to-end contract leadership, strategic negotiations, and function development within the Energy & Natural Resources sectors.
Ideal candidates will have over 10 years’ experience in supply chain and contract management, focusing on international environments. This position offers a pivotal role in shaping commercial strategies and ensuring governance standards are upheld.
